What Is a Salon Suite and Why Is It a Game-Changer?
A salon suite is a private, self-contained space within a larger salon complex, allowing beauty professionals to operate independently. Unlike traditional salons, where multiple professionals share a single space, salon suites provide a level of autonomy, privacy, and control over your business environment. This setup is rapidly increasing in popularity due to its numerous advantages such as customizable ambiance, flexible scheduling, and a personalized client experience.
Understanding salon suite rental cost is vital because it directly influences your pricing, profitability, and capacity for growth. The decision to rent a suite isn't solely about price—it involves evaluating the value of the space, amenities, location, and potential for expansion.
The Factors Influencing Salon Suite Rental Cost
Numerous elements contribute to the overall salon suite rental cost. Recognizing these will help you budget appropriately and select a suite that offers the best return on investment. Here are the core factors:
1. Location and Market Dynamics
High-traffic urban centers and affluent neighborhoods usually command higher rental rates due to increased client accessibility and demand. Conversely, suites in suburban or emerging markets might offer lower costs but provide opportunities for growth as the clientele base develops.
2. Size of the Suite
The square footage directly impacts rental prices. Larger suites, which can accommodate multiple stations or additional amenities, generally come with higher costs. For solo professionals, a smaller, more affordable space might suffice initially.
3. Amenities and Infrastructure
Luxury amenities such as modern cabinetry, high-quality lighting, climate control, water supply, and Wi-Fi increase the value of a suite and, consequently, its rental price. Additional features like reception services or shared retail space can also influence costs.
4. Lease Terms and Payment Options
Monthly, quarterly, or yearly lease agreements can vary in price. Longer-term leases often provide more favorable rates, but they also require a greater initial financial commitment. Flexible leases might cost slightly more per month but offer adaptability.
5. Competition and Demand
In markets with a high density of beauty professionals, rental rates tend to be more competitive, impacting the salon suite rental cost. The demand for premium spaces influences pricing strategies employed by suite providers.
Average Salon Suite Rental Cost Across Markets
While prices vary depending on location and amenities, understanding average costs provides useful benchmarks. Typical ranges include:
- Urban downtown areas: $600 – $1,500 per month
- Suburban areas: $400 – $900 per month
- Luxury suites with high-end amenities: $1,200 – $2,500+ per month
It’s important to note that in some markets, all-inclusive suites with comprehensive amenities may come at a premium, but offer additional value that can help attract premium clients.

How to Manage and Reduce Salon Suite Rental Cost
Although some costs are fixed, savvy professionals and entrepreneurs have strategies to optimize expenses:
- Negotiate lease terms: Secure favorable terms or discounts for longer commitments.
- Choose appropriate suite size: Start small and expand as your clientele grows.
- Consider location carefully: Balance cost savings with accessibility and visibility.
- Share amenities: Pool resources with other professionals to reduce individual expenses.
- Invest in quality: Durable, modern decor and equipment can reduce maintenance costs and attract clients.
